9 / 22 page TLE 4470 Semiconductor Group 9 1998-11-01 Electrical Characteristics V I1 = VI2 = 14 V; VDIS < VDISL; – 40 °C < Tj < 150 °C; unless otherwise specified Parameter Symbol Limit Values Unit Test Condition min. typ. max. Stand-by Regulator Output 1 Output voltage V Q1 4.90 5.0 5.10 V 1 mA < I Q1 <100 mA Output current limitation I Q1 180 280 – mA see note 1 Output drop voltage; V DRQ1 = VI1 – VQ1 V DRQ1 – 300 500 mV I Q1 = 100 mA; see note 1 Current Consumption Quiescent current; stand-by I q = II1 – IQ1 I q – 180 250 µA I Q1 = 300 µA; Tj = 25 °C V DIS > VDISH – 180 300 µA I Q1 = 300 µA; V DIS > VDISH Quiescent current I q = II1 – IQ1 I q –4 6 mA I Q1 = 100 mA Regulator Performance Load regulation ∆V Q1 –15 50 mV 1 mA < I Q1 <150 mA; Load regulation ∆V Q1 –5 25 mV 1 mA < I Q1 <100 mA; Line regulation ∆V Q1 –5 20 mV IQ1 = 1 mA; 6V< V I1 <28V Power-Supply-Ripple- Rejection PSRR –60 – dB 20 Hz < f r <20 kHz; V r = 5 VSS Temperature output voltage drift ∆V Q1/∆T – 0.3 – mV/K – d V I1/dt stability V Q1 4.5 – 5.5 V no reset occurs; note 3 Value of output capacitance C Q1 6– – µF– ESR of output capacitance R ESRQ1 –– 10 Ω at 10 kHz |
